Understanding Nerve Conduction Testing
Nerve conduction testing is a diagnostic procedure used to evaluate the electrical activity of nerves and identify potential causes of symptoms like numbness or tingling in various parts of the body, including the hands and feet. This non-invasive technique plays a crucial role in determining nerve damage or compression, which can result from conditions such as carpal tunnel syndrome, pinched nerves in the lower back, or other neurological disorders.
During the test, a healthcare provider uses electrical impulses to stimulate nerves, while specialized equipment measures the speed and strength of nerve signals as they travel through the body. By analyzing these results, doctors can pinpoint areas of nerve impairment, helping them diagnose and develop appropriate treatment plans, such as suggesting chiropractic care for lower back pain associated with pinched nerves.
Identifying Common Causes of Numbness and Tingling
Numbness and tingling are common symptoms that can arise from various underlying causes. Through nerve conduction testing, healthcare professionals can identify specific issues affecting the nervous system, offering a clear diagnosis for effective treatment. This non-invasive procedure helps uncover conditions like carpal tunnel syndrome, where pressure on a nerve in the wrist leads to tingling in the hands and fingers. Similarly, it can detect peripheral neuropathy, a nerve damage condition often associated with diabetes, causing numbness or pain in the extremities.
Other common causes include compression or irritation of nerves in the neck or lower back, resulting in radiating symptoms down the arms or legs.
